Does Meta have a cryptocurrency?

Meta’s Novi pilot—a money-transfer service using the company’s own cryptocurrency digital wallet—will end on Sept. 1, the service said on its website, a link to which it texted to its users. Both the Novi app and Novi on WhatsApp will no longer be available, the company said on the Website.

How do you buy Meta pay?

If you’re new to Meta Pay, it’s easy to set up:
  1. Go to Payments settings.
  2. Enter your payment method and account information.
  3. Use Meta Pay the next time you make a purchase, donate, or send money across our technologies or anywhere you see the Meta Pay button when shopping online.

What is meta Pay on Facebook?

Meta Pay will work in the same way as Facebook Pay. To shop, donate, and send money across Meta technologies or to make purchases using the Meta Pay button, you’ll need to have Meta Pay linked with a payment method. If you’ve already linked a payment method to Facebook Pay, there is no action needed on your part.

How do I add meta Pay to PayPal?

How to use PayPal with Meta Quest
  1. Open the Meta Quest app on your phone.
  2. Tap your profile picture in the top left.
  3. Select Payment Methods.
  4. Select Add a PayPal account.
  5. Log in through PayPal and follow the onscreen instructions.

Why is meta Pay not working?

A Meta Pay account can be disabled for any of the following reasons: Your identity has not been validated. As a regulated financial service, Payments in Messenger is required to validate your identity at certain times. To send or receive money in Messenger again, Meta Pay will need your help to verify your identity.

How much does Facebook Pay you for 1 million views?

On average, 1 million views pays about $1,000, Shaba said. Sometimes, a video with about 1 million views can earn upward of $1,500 depending on the CPM rate, or cost per thousand views, Nonny added. (Insider verified these earnings with screenshots of their Facebook creator studio.)

What does Facebook Pay per 1000 views?

Facebook’s ad campaigns generate an average of $8.75 per 1,000 views, according to the Social Media Examiner. Tubefilter found Facebook creator revenue fluctuated in 2020, with some influencers generating millions of dollars off the site, while others with millions of views received little to no pay out.

Can banks refund scammed money?

If you’ve bought something from a scammer

If you’ve paid for something you haven’t received, you might be able to get your money back. Your card provider can ask the seller’s bank to refund the money. This is known as the ‘chargeback scheme’. If you paid by debit card, you can use chargeback however much you paid.

What can a scammer do with my phone number?

Your phone number is an easy access point for scammers and identity thieves. Once they know your number, they can use it to send you phishing texts, trick you into installing malware and spyware, or use social engineering attacks to get you to hand over your personal identifying information (PII).
